I have imported from Catia in NX a stp file from a solid.
The conversion looks strange.......The solid has face/s that is not shown!

If you have a look at the original model you supplied and run Analysis - Examine Geometry on it, you will find NX reports both Self intersections and consistency problems.
One of the faces is a "Non manifold" condition which NX/ Parasolid don't like but which the Heal geometry cures.

Yes, the file- export - heal geometry , - that you already have used :-)
what i am saying is that one face of the imported body is "corrupt", selfintersecting. Probably due to that Catia and Parasolids handles "special cases" differently.
